Average Firefighters Salary in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L

Firefighters in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L area earn an average annual salary of $61,340, significantly exceeding the national average of $43,380. This higher compensation is often driven by the specific demands and responsibilities inherent to the role within this metropolitan region, alongside local economic factors that influence pay scales.

Firefighters Salary Distribution in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L

Salary progression for firefighters in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ater typically scales with experience. Entry-level positions may start closer to the lower end of the pay scale, while seasoned professionals with extensive training and years of service can command significantly higher salaries, often reaching into the upper percentiles. These percentile gaps clearly signify career advancement and increased earning potential.

Experience LevelMarket PercentileAnnual WageHourly Rate
Cadet / RecruitAcademy training and probationary period.10% (Entry)$41,270$19.8
OfficerPatrol duties, handling standard calls.25% (Junior)$46,005$22.1
Senior OfficerField training officer, specialized unit.50% (Median)$60,360$29
Sergeant / Lt.Shift supervisor, squad leader.75% (Senior)$76,675$36.9
Captain / ChiefDepartment command and administration.90% (Expert)$79,830$38.4

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 2,820 employees in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L area with a job density of 1.953 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
